First some updates on how I have decided to allocate my time on campus. After some serious deliberation I decided to join the Graduate Consulting Group, Graduate Finance Association and the Sports, Entertainment and Media Association. All three of the group’s offer unique career preparation and resources to prepare individuals both inside and outside of the classroom. Just this week the GFA lead a career trek to Wall Street, the GCG rolled out their new Case Preparation Mentorship program and SEMA finalized the details on the SEMA ’09 Sports Entertainment and Media Business Conference. The breadth and quality of these offerings speak volumes about the passion and leadership abilities of the students who run the organizations.

I also was fortunate enough to be selected for the McCombs Admissions Committee. The MAC plays a crucial support role to the Admissions staff in cultivating relationships with prospective students. It is a great opportunity to give back to the program as well as aide in the formation of the next class. My interactions with MAC members, while I was deciding on which business school to attend, were huge factors in my ultimate decision to come to McCombs.

Finally, I was given the opportunity to lead a Plus Project with Deloitte Consulting. As a career switcher, wanting to transition to the field of Management Consulting, I am excited about the real-world experience the project provides. Working closely with an elite consulting firm such as Deloitte is both rewarding and challenging and has offered me a glimpse into what my future career may entail. It is this type of real world application that makes the Plus Program such a differentiating feature of McCombs.
